A parasite cannot live alone.
African Saying
A parent who excuses his child’s ways makes him a thief.
Yoruban Saying
A partner in evil will also be a partner in punishment.
Roman Proverb
A patch of grass between two fighting buffaloes cannot survive.
Burmese Saying
A patient mind is the best remedy for trouble.
Roman Saying
A patient woman can roast an ox with a lantern.
Chinese Proverb
A peaceful home is a happy home.
German Saying
A peacock has too little in its head, too much in its tail.
Swedish Saying
A pearl from an old oyster.
Chinese Saying
A peasant between two lawyers is like a fish between two cats.
Spanish Proverb
A peasant will stand on the top of a hill for a very long time with his mouth open before a roast duck will fly in.
Spanish Saying
A peck of March dust is worth a king’s ransom.
Spanish Saying
A peddler who cannot pass off mouse droppings for pepper has not learned his trade.
German Saying
A penniless man will pick the largest cake.
Korean Proverb
A penny for an ox, and you haven’t got a penny!
Yiddish Saying
A penny in the purse is better than a friend at court.
English Saying
A penny in time is as good as a dollar.
Danish Proverb
A penny is a lot of money – if you haven’t got a penny.
Yiddish Saying
A penny is sometimes better spent than spared.
Yiddish Saying
A penny saved is a penny earned.
English Saying
A penny spared is twice got.
English Proverb
A pennyworth of mirth is worth a pound of sorrow.
English Saying
A people without faith in themselves cannot survive
Chinese Saying
A people without history is like wind on the buffalo grass.
Native American Saying
A persistent beggar never sleeps on an empty stomach.
Spanish Proverb
A person born to be a flower pot will not go beyond the porch.
Mexican Saying
A person cannot be judged by his appearance in the same token as the sea cannot be measured with a bucket.
Chinese Saying
A person changing his clothing always hides while changing.
Kenyan Saying
A person does not seek luck; luck seeks the person.
Turkish Proverb
A person eating must make crumbs.
Sicilian Saying
A person engaged in various pursuits, minds none well.
Roman Saying
A person gives nothing who has nothing.
Roman Saying
A person in misery is a sacred matter.
Roman Proverb
A person is blessed once, but his troubles never come alone.
Chinese Saying
A person is known by the company he keeps.
English Saying
A person moves up while water runs down.
Chinese Saying
A person needs a face; a tree needs bark.
Chinese Proverb
A person of high principles is one who can watch an entire chess game without making a comment.
Chinese Saying
A person washes only once with fire.
Hausan Saying
A person who bows never gets his cheek slapped.
Korean Saying
A person who misses a chance and the monkey who misses its branch can’t be saved.
Indian Proverb
A person who say it cannot be done should not interrupt the man doing it.
Chinese Saying
A person whose heart is not content is like a snake which tries to swallow an elephant.
Chinese Saying
